Course Unit Description

The aim of this course is to acquaint students with the nutrition of farm animals and with the feedstuffs and a system of their evaluation, and with the use of feed additives. Students should learn to take samples of feed, perform their fundamental analysis in the chemical laboratory and examine samples of feed in terms of quality. Students should be able to consider animal nutrition and feeding problems and make qualified decisions.

Specific competences:

  • A capability to apply knowledge and skills concerning feedstuffs and calculation of feeding rations in practice
  • Ability to assess the appropriateness of treatment and preservation of foods for certain species and categories of animals
  • Ability to define the essential nutrients in animal body and know their functions, needs and resources.
  • Ability to characterize each individual feed and assess their suitability and safety for the different types and categories of livestock
  • Ability to use knowledge on feeds to create the feed formulation and feed rations for individual livestock
